Everyone has small openings in their skin that allow sweat and natural oils to escape, helping the body regulate itself.
For some people, however, these pores can be more sensitive or problematic than others, reacting easily to dirt, oil, or environmental factors.
When pores don’t function as smoothly as they should, they can become irritated or blocked, leading to visible skin concerns.
Clogged pores are actually quite common and can occur for a variety of reasons, including excess oil production or buildup of dead skin cells.
These blockages may appear more frequently in certain individuals, depending on skin type, hygiene habits, or genetics.
